Transaction 34f52e767893db788cfffc7b68242af0295987b64c6b73eb0665241ebb753e7e
1 Input
2 Outputs
- 34f52e767893db788cfffc7b68242af0295987b64c6b73eb0665241ebb753e7e:0
- 34f52e767893db788cfffc7b68242af0295987b64c6b73eb0665241ebb753e7e:1
value 430000000
address 1FwaJ6NBz9NmtGCiq7HEseVs9Vk7A5N2tT
value 157160000
address 1FS3C7MQaVZe2jnRkbTRhhGcPgVFqsuKrn